#293dcc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#293dcc is composed of 16.1% red, 23.9%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.9%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 232.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 48%. #293dcc color hex could be obtained by blending #527aff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#293dcc color description : Strong blue.
#293dcc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#293dcc has RGB values of R:41, G:61,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2702796.

Shades and Tints of #293dcc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020208 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#293dcc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747681 is the less saturated color, while #0321f2 is the most saturated one.
